- Materials:
- 1 cup baking soda
- 1 cup cornstarch
- 1 cup water
- Food coloring (various colors)
- 1 cup vinegar (for the fizzy reaction)
- Mixing bowls
- Whisk or spoon
- Containers for storage (like jars or cups)
- Full Step-by-Step:
Step 1: Mix the Dry Ingredients
- In a mixing bowl, combine 1 cup of baking soda and 1 cup of cornstarch.
- Whisk until well combined, noticing the fine texture as it forms.
Step 2: Add Water
- Gradually stir in 1 cup of water.
- Mix until you achieve a smooth, pourable consistency. Feel the mixture between your fingers—it should be soft but hold shape.
Step 3: Add Color
- Divide the mixture into different cups.
- Add a few drops of food coloring to each cup, mixing thoroughly.
- Enjoy the vibrant transformations as the colors blend in!
Step 4: Paint and Fizz
- Grab your paintbrush and start applying the mixture to your chosen surface.
- For an exciting twist, pour a small amount of vinegar over your painted area and watch the fizz!
- Tips & Variations:
- Customize Colors: Experiment with different food coloring combinations to create unique hues.
- Swap Out Ingredients: For a thicker consistency, add more cornstarch. For a thinner paint, add additional water.
- Add Glitter:Mix in some glitter for extra sparkle.
- Create Stencils: Use cut-out shapes for themed designs!
- Frequently Asked Questions:
Q1: Can I use other types of paint instead of food coloring?
A1: Food coloring works best for bright colors, but you can experiment with natural dyes like beet juice or turmeric for more earth-toned shades.
Q2: How can I store leftover paint?
A2: Store any unused paint in airtight containers in the refrigerator for up to a week. Stir well before use.
Q3: Is this paint washable?
A3: Yes! The paint can be washed off with water, but it’s best to test surfaces first.
Q4: Can I use this paint for outdoor projects?
A4: Yes, it’s suitable for outdoor use; however, it may not be as durable as traditional outdoor paints.
